Iam using MI 7.0, and in the current senario we are exporting all our applications from NWDS individually to get the expected output.

Now the problem is :- if i want to synchronize the applications directly from MI Client i get only one applications output(which was previously exported from NWDS) and the when i click on the other applications it is diplaying page can not found exception..

If I export the same application (which is showing the exception) from NWDS it is displaying the output..

Sso now i want to see all the applications output without exporting from the NWDS and directly form MI Client...

you need to register the Apps inside your MI client. This is done while downloading your Apps from MI Middleware server. Once this is done you can simply rename the folder of the app, place a new WAR file inside yoir MI client and restart MI client. This will extract the WAR file to the relevant folder and all is fine from there. But as I said: without the initial deployment of the app from I middleware you can most likely not do what you want to do.
